多人开发的项目,难免会出现代码风格不一致,而出现一些问题。统一代码风格能避免一些错误,提升开发体验,提高开发效率。为统一代码风格,在项目中引入eslint等插件,期望达到以下以下几点: 开发过程中,对不规范代码给予提示 能够对代码进行...
网上有很多一篇文章就总结了整个前端的技术体系,或者一篇文章就能事无巨细地列示了所有的前端知识点,我觉得作为 web 开发知识点的查漏补缺是非常棒的。 但像我这样已经工作了几年的角度来看的话,可能背不下来,也还可能不太能理解诸如“ HTM...
照常浏览vuejs官网,在动画这一章节,看到基于侦听器的动画 基于侦听器的动画 通过发挥一些创意,我们可以基于一些数字状态,配合侦听器给任何东西加上动画。例如,我们可以将数字本身变成动画: 刚好我也在看vue-count-to组件,...
为了更直观的体验,我这里就从头创建了一个新的项目来配置eslint等相关配置,这里就跳过项目初始化步骤 ps: 本文全篇采用pnpm来当包管理器,有些命令可能与npm 不同 ps: 如果你使用的是vsCode, 那么强烈建议你安装 es...
前言 前端在等设计的时间真得有点难顶,闲了快半个月了,疯狂找事做! 分析一下? 实现一个时钟,本来就是想要实现比较细节的过渡效果,立马想起电子时钟的显示模型。就用像计算器那样的数字展示效果啦~ 拆分一下? 电子时钟的时间,格式大概...
看了本篇你能收获什么? 如何显示多层级的树形菜单?嵌套路由是唯一的实现方式吗? 如何规避嵌套路由使用KeepAvlie缓存失效的问题? vue2的路由和vue3在使用上有哪些区别? 哈希模式和history模式有什么区别?哈希模式...
继承 继承(inheritance)是面向对象语言中最为津津乐道的概念,在许多面向对象语言中都支持两种继承方式,接口继承和实现继承。 接口继承:只继承方法签名 实现继承:继承实际的方法 在 JavaScript 中只支持实现继...
前言 “磨刀不误砍柴工”。大家好?,今天给大家简单介绍一个在浏览器中debugger代码的方法,同时给了一个小案例,结合实际讲解。最后简单阐述使用console.log调试代码和使用断点调试代码的一些个人见解。(大佬可绕路…) 第一...
细粒度响应式 细粒度响应式由一些primitive组成。 signal signal是响应式系统最基本的组件,它由getter,setter,value组成。在一些文章中,也称为Observable,Atom,Subject, Ref...
在现代 Web 开发中,前端自动化已经成为了必不可少的一部分。随着项目规模的增加和开发人员的增多,手动部署已经无法满足需求,因为手动部署容易出错,而且需要大量的时间和精力。因此,自动化部署已经成为了前端开发的趋势。在本文中,我们将介绍前...